Also, what you didn't realize was that FBi internet radio is broadcast at 64 kbps in AAC+ format, just as it's displayed right here, and the proper setting for an audio capture at this bit rate should be double this, which is 128 kbps. That's the setting I used. You encoded with a bit rate of 192 kbps. Not much difference, but rule of thumb is however many the number of kbps one plans to capture from a digital radio broadcast, the magic number is double. So if it's broadcast at 48 kbps the magic number is 96 kbps, broadcast at 96 kbps and the number is 192 kbps, & on and on. Anymore than this and the only thing you are achieving is bloating the size of your file.
